What are you looking for???

Diesel? Gaz? Big? Small? with or without transmission? Bolt in place or heavily modified mouting?

There's a world of possibillity.

Do you want to drag with your Bus? If so you should get the corvette LS1. Probably the best crate engine.

Otherwise, I'd suggest you do a hole lot of research before you start modifying your bus because it's a slippery way downhill to being broke.

Major thing you'll have to consider before anything:

1. Fitting (does the new engine you want's will fit in the VW bus engine bay
2. Transmission compatibility
3. Will you do a stand alone engine or will your rewire all the sensor in your van
4. The list is to long to go on but I think you get the point.

Diesel engine : find a 2.8L from the L400
Gaz: Find a Civic, Dodge caravan, Toyota Rav4 2.0L, VW 1.8T engine (fast)

But it's the kind of project you'll either pay a mechanic a LOT of money or that will be a life project for you if you indeed have the mechanical, fabricating, welding, etc kind of knowledge
